[MARKET UPDATE] Bitcoin falls under USD 70,000 for the first time since November 2024

Bitcoin's drop below USD 70,000 marks a significant technical level and a psychological barrier, reflecting potential bearish sentiment in the crypto market.

Context

This move could trigger further selling pressure as traders reassess their positions, particularly with the long-term trend now showing signs of reversal. Keep an eye on the implications for altcoins and broader risk sentiment, as this breakdown may influence investor behavior across other asset classes.
